2024 Baseball Roster

Jersey Number 7
Sandyn Cuthrell
- Position:
- IF
- Class:
- Junior
- Height:
- 6-2
- Weight:
- 195
- Hometown:
- Cass City, Mich.
- High School:
- Cass City
2024: Appeared in 14 games with four starts (three in left field; one in center) … had first career hit and scored first career run vs. Northern Illinois (April 27) … hit safely in four consecutive games April 27-May 5 … doubled for first career extra-base hit vs. Akron (May 5).
2023: Appeared in four games.
2022: Did not play.
2021: Redshirted
High School: Earned 11 varsity letters at Cass City High School heading into senior year … served as team captain in football, basketball and baseball … hit .417 as a junior … named All-Greater Thumb Conference First Team twice and Second Team once … four-time All-GTC selection in football … All-State honorable mention in football (2018), in basketball (2017-18), and in baseball (2018) … earned Golden Helmet Award from MLive three times in football career … three-time all-conference selection in football … played summer ball for Michigan Select from 2012-20, coached by Mark Jebb, Norman Kapala and George Ross.
